aight.. since you disconnected your battery.. all your features will now need to be syncronized.. this means hold each window switch in the up position.. not the express position though.. for 3 seconds and that will be restored.. next run your sunroof through a full open pop up and close.. then full open and close.
you willl need to run your steering from lock to lock twice and then back to centre position to restore steering angle sensor, and you already did your radio code so your good.
to remove the cd changer, you will need to remove the 2 screws that are in the brakcet.. then unplug the cd changer.. next remove the 4 screws that hold the cd changer in the bracket.

it sound like you need to have your cd changer rebuilt.. take it to the dealer and have them send it out for repairs.. cheaper than an new cd changer and will work just as good.

There was actually an older 129 SL500 in with cd changer problems.. but we found that one of the cd's in the magazine was bad casuing the cd player to say no magazine. once that cd was removed from the magazine it worked. but since you've tried many different things already.. looks like its the cd changer itself.
